Nice looking corals and clams. what type of lights are you using..

Thanks!

I am using a 12 bulb Sfiligoi T5 fixture. I took out the middle 4 bulbs and replaced them with a 250w metal halide.

4 ATI Blue+ that run for 12hours
3 ATI Blue+ and 1 Fiji Pink that run for 9.5 hours
and the Halide runs for 7.5 hours.

The lights follow the lunar cycle along with my moon lights. I find I get the nicest colours with this combination and everything seems to grow fairly quick as well. Im getting roughly 650 par on the shelf in the middle where the clam and forest fire digi are.

I tried to change to a 14k ushio but found the par readings were far to high and I just burnt everything under it...
